Being an avid and pro 2nd A. Believer, there are many places I want to explore, however, I feel a bit safer with a side arm if you will. Researching many a clues, I am looking at remote wilderness areas out and away from the general public.
Licensed to "Own" a firearm is much different than the elusive, next to impossible to obtain CCW in California, to which I do not have.
Just curious on everyone's thoughts as to carrying a firearm while detecting, and, it seems as though while wearing earphones it is a little behind the eight ball so to speak (as I would be challenged to hear anything but the sounds of the detector), but, that said, I would "feel" more secure.
So, do you carry while detecting in remote areas?

As a police officer i always carry, even detecting. Not that i honestly feel threatened its just the way i am. Its unnatural for me to not carry. On the other hand the alot of people i see carry have no business. Untrained, inexperienced, ill equipped. It is something that may have landowners feel uneasy. When i see someone with a HiPoint in a $10 nylon snap closure holster walking around with their weapon uncovered hanging off their a** it makes me want to bang my head on a wall. If you are gonna carry train, practice, research, spend the $ on a reliable weapon and holster/retention. Not calling anyone out, just my 2c.

Yes, my husband and I carry if we will be deep in the woods where dangerous animals may be present. My firearm would probably just piss off a bear, but my husband's would do damage. If we do run into a bear, for example, that appears to not be afraid of us, then hopefully just firing off into the sky will do the trick. If not, that's going to be an "oh $hit" moment. Otherwise, we are not close to high crime areas, so that is the only time we feel it is necessary to carry.
Regarding the OP's comment about having on your headphones while detecting so that one may not hear danger approaching, we just keep the headphone on one ear and slide forward of the other ear, plus we have our dog with us for an alarm system.
